- 179
- 0
- 约2.35万字
- 约 29页
- 2016-12-14 发布于北京
- 举报
浅析倍增思想在信息学竞赛中的应用
安徽省芜湖市第一中学 朱晨光
目 录
摘要 2
关键字 2
正文 2
引言 2
应用之一 在变化规则相同的情况下加速状态转移 2
应用之二 加速区间操作 8
一个有趣的探讨 11
总结 12
感谢 12
参考文献 13
附录 13
摘要
倍增思想是解决信息学问题的一种独特而巧妙的思想。本文就倍增思想在信息学竞赛中两个方面的应用进行了分析。全文可以分为五个部分:
第一部分引言,简要阐述了倍增思想的重要作用以及运用方法;
第二部分介绍倍增思想的第一个应用——在变化规则相同的情况下加速状态转移;
第三部分介绍倍增思想的第二个应用——加速对区间进行的操作;
第四部分探讨了一个有趣的问题,即为什么倍增思想每次只将考虑范围扩大一倍而不是两倍、三倍等;
第五部分总结全文,再次指出倍增思想的重要性以及应该怎样灵活运用倍增思想。
关键字
倍增思想 变化规则 状态转移 区间操作
正文
引言
倍增思想是一种十分巧妙的思想,在当今的信息学竞赛中应用得十分广泛。尽管倍增思想可以应用在许多不同的场合,但总的来说,它的本质是:每次根据已经得到的信息,将考虑的范围扩大一倍,从而加速操作。大家所熟悉的归并排序实际上就是倍增思想的一个经典应用。
在解决信息学问题方面,倍增思想主要有这两个方面的应用——
在变化规则相同的情况下加速状态转移
原创力文档

文档评论(0)